The Small Business Cost Challenge
Small fintechs operate on tight budgets. Traditional call center solutions require per-seat licenses, long-term contracts, and significant setup fees. Voice bots offer pay-as-you-go models, but startups must evaluate:
• Upfront Costs: Setup fees, customization, integration.
• Recurring Costs: Monthly subscription, per-minute charges, overage fees.
• Hidden Costs: Training, maintenance, support.
Common Voice Bot Pricing Models
| Model | Description | Best For |
| Per Seat / Per User | Monthly fee per agent (human or bot) | Teams with consistent call volume |
| Per Minute | Pay for actual call minutes | Low-volume or seasonal businesses |
| Per Conversation | Flat fee per successful interaction | Lead generation, appointment setting |
| Tiered Subscription | Monthly fee based on call volume tiers | Growing businesses |
| Free + Overage | Base free tier, pay beyond limits | Very small startups testing the waters |

How to Choose the Right Pricing Model
• Low Call Volume (< 1,000 calls/month): Per-minute or free tier with overage.
• Medium Volume (1,000–10,000 calls/month): Tiered subscription or per-minute with volume discount.
• High Volume (> 10,000 calls/month): Negotiate custom enterprise pricing.
Cost-Saving Tips for Small Fintechs
• Start with a Pilot: Use free trial to validate ROI before scaling.
• Automate High-Volume Calls: Focus voice bots on routine inquiries (balance checks, payment reminders).
• Use Hybrid Model: Route complex calls to humans; automate the rest.
• Monitor Usage: Analytics help identify waste and optimize call flows.
